Myrtle Crumb books in order

The Myrtle Crumb series by Gayle Trent follows an opinionated elderly woman who solves mysteries in her small Southern town across seven books.

Myrtle Crumb is the kind of neighbor who notices everything and says exactly what she thinks about it. Gayle Trent’s series follows this opinionated older woman as she gets mixed up in murders and mishaps in her small Southern community. The books blend cozy mystery conventions with a healthy dose of humor, powered by Myrtle’s personality.

Starting with Between a Clutch and a Hard Place in 2004, the series ran through seven entries ending with The Party Line in 2015. Titles like Soup…Er…Myrtle! and Perp and Circumstance give a sense of the tone: lighthearted mysteries with a protagonist who is funnier than she probably realizes.

Who is Myrtle Crumb?

Myrtle Crumb is an outspoken, sharp-witted elderly woman who gets involved in local crimes despite having no official investigative authority. Her strong personality and blunt observations drive the humor and mystery in each book.
